We reviewed the read-replica lag alarm that paged twice last week. The alarm fires when replication lag on the reporting replica exceeds 90 seconds for three consecutive checks. New team members should note: brief spikes during the nightly export are expected and auto-resolve; sustained lag usually means a long-running analytics query holding back replay. The runbook covers safe query cancellation and when to promote a fresh replica. Ongoing ownership of the alarm and runbook sits with the engineer below.

named custodian: Brivan Eliath Quenox Frador

## Tuning

The Parcelfox webhook batches carrier events before delivery. Plugins can adjust batch size, flush interval, and retry backoff. Defaults suit moderate traffic; raise batch size for high-volume carriers, lower flush interval for latency-sensitive consumers. All values are read at startup only. The defaults are listed below.

constants for kahag-yagag:
BUDGETS = {
    "tamax": 449,
    "holiel": 156,
    "isteth": 181,
    "silath": 575,
    "zorys": 821,
    "briax": 1007,
    "quenox": 276,
}

## Artifact Signing for LintScribe Plugins

All third-party LintScribe plugins must ship a signed manifest before they appear in the plugin registry. The release bot verifies signatures against the key published by the Docwright maintainers at Verrell Labs. Unsigned bundles are rejected at upload time, no exceptions. Verify your local toolchain uses the current public key, shown below.

signing key of bagap-yawep = bky13_TbfT6ZMUoGJo2

## Deployment

The Coppergate service fronts the Marlow upstream API and ships with a circuit breaker enabled by default. On deploy, the breaker starts closed and trips once the rolling error rate crosses the threshold; half-open probes resume traffic gradually. Reviewers should check that any change to retry logic keeps the breaker as the outer layer, otherwise retries can mask upstream failures. The breaker and rollout behavior are driven entirely by the configuration values below.

settings of bawif-fawif:
ralix:
  log_level: warn
  metrics_host: metrics.ralix.tolvaqsys.internal
  pool_size: 32